Abstract

Infective endocarditis (IE) is a life-threatening condition often manifesting as a multisystem disease. The clinical presentations are heterogeneous making the diagnosis sometimes difficult. We report the case of a 59-year -old presented to the emergency department with acute abdominal pain. In this context, endocarditis was suspected. Transesophageal echocardiography (TOE) was realized confirming the diagnosis and the abdominal pain was explained by to mesenteric ischemia.
